nginx fastcgi
2016-08-11 21:51:24 0 举报
Nginx FastCGI是一个在Nginx服务器上运行的PHP解释器。FastCGI是一种协议,它允许在一个进程池中处理来自Web服务器的请求。与传统的CGI模式相比,FastCGI可以提供更高的性能和更好的安全性。通过使用Nginx FastCGI,您可以在不牺牲性能的情况下处理大量的并发请求。此外,FastCGI还提供了一种简单的方法来管理多个PHP版本,这意味着您可以在同一台服务器上同时运行多个版本的PHP。总之,Nginx FastCGI是一个强大而灵活的解决方案,适用于需要高性能和高可用性的Web应用程序。
作者其他创作
大纲/内容
fastcgi
wrapper
信号
master进程
Application2
socket通信
这个wrapper需要完成的工作:1、通过调用fastcgi(库)的函数通过socket和ningx通信(读写socket是fastcgi内部实现的功能,对wrapper是非透明的)2、调度thread,进行fork和kill3、和application(php)进行通信
worker进程
Application3
Application1
nginx
Internet

收藏
0 条评论
下一页